  • I love the overall look and feel of this. As I said in my first comment, your use of long master shots is excellent. Film students tend to think that they need to cut from one shot to another every two seconds, which I find annoying.

    What camera settings, if any, did you use to get this look? I reminds me of silver halide black and white photography, which is probably why I like this vid so much.

  • Uhm, outside the use of 25p I don't rememeber the settings really. But it was instantly recorded in black & white, with a bit of color correction in post, mainly to up the contrast to simulate the look of film footage. So I think it was mainly the post-production to get this effect.
